聯系我們 - 廣告服務 - 聯系電話:
您的當前位置: > 關注 > > 正文

焦點資訊:跳躍忍者怎么玩?若吃完所有能量球最多能保留多少能量?

來源:CSDN 時間:2022-12-12 08:39:36

題目描述


(相關資料圖)

跳躍忍者很能跳,因此他很嘚瑟。他每次跳需要消耗能量,每跳1米就會消耗1點能量,如果他有很多能量就能跳很高。

他為了收集能量,來到了一個神秘的地方,這個地方凡人是進不來的。在這里,他的正上方每100米處就有一個能量球(也就是這些能量球位于海拔100,200,300……米處),每個能量球所能提供的能量是不同的,一共有N個能量球(也就是最后一個能量球在N×100米處)。他為了想收集能量,想跳著吃完所有的能量球。他可以自由控制他每次跳的高度,接著他跳起把這個高度以下的能量球都吃了,他便能獲得能量球內的能量,接著吃到的能量球消失。他不會輕功,也不會二段跳,所以他不能因新吃到的能量而變化此次跳躍的高度。并且他還是生活在地球上的,所以每次跳完都會掉下來。

問跳躍忍者若要吃完所有的能量球,最多還能保留多少能量。

輸入

第1行包含兩個正整數N,M,表示了能量球的個數和跳躍忍者的初始能量。

第2行包含N個非負整數,從左到右第I個數字依次從下向上描述了位于I×100米位置能量球包含的能量,整數之間用空格隔開。

對于10%的數據,有N≤10;    對于20%的數據,有N≤100;    對于40%的數據,有N≤1000;    對于70%的數據,有N≤100000;    對于100%的數據,有N≤2000000。

保證對于所有數據,跳躍忍者都能吃到所有的能量球,并且能量球包含的能量之和不超過2^31-1。

輸出

僅包括一個 非負整數 ,為跳躍忍者吃完所有能量球后最多保留的能量。

樣例輸入

3 200200 200 200

樣例輸出

400

責任編輯:

標簽:

相關推薦:

精彩放送:

新聞聚焦
Top 岛国精品在线